Marysville (MI) to Buy Fire Equipment for Fire Apparatus, Ambulances

Marysville approved the purchase of new radios for its fire trucks and ambulances, reports Voice News.

The radios for the fire trucks are from Digicom Global, which carries Kenwood equipment, for about $12,980, and for the ambulances from AMK Services, which specializes in Tait electronics, for about $4,880.

The total of the two purchases is roughly $17,850. The grant will pick all but a local match of 5%, or $893.
